How to study IB Biology SL

IB Biology SL connects biological understanding across four themes—unity and diversity, form and function, interaction and interdependence, and continuity and change—and four levels of organisation: molecules, cells, organisms, and ecosystems. The current course began teaching in August or September 2023 and was first assessed in 2025. SL prioritises secure core mechanisms, accurate data interpretation, and concise evidence-based explanations.

Assessment at a glance

For the current IB Biology SL course first assessed in 2025, external assessment contributes 80% and the individual scientific investigation contributes 20%. Confirm the examination session and practical requirements with your school.

ComponentFormatWeighting
Paper 11 hour 30 minutes; Paper 1A multiple choice and Paper 1B data-based questions36%
Paper 21 hour 30 minutes; data-based, short-answer, and extended-response questions44%
Internal assessment10 hours; individual scientific investigation, maximum 3,000 words20%

Revision plan

  1. 1.Map each topic to its theme and level of organisation so connections across molecules, cells, organisms, and ecosystems remain visible.
  2. 2.Reconstruct biological mechanisms from memory with labelled diagrams and ordered cause-and-effect steps.
  3. 3.Practise Paper 1B and Paper 2 data questions by separating observation, interpretation, conclusion, and limitation.
  4. 4.Use mixed-topic sets to connect form with function, interactions with consequences, and continuity with change.

Exam strategy

Read the command term and identify the biological scale being tested. Build mechanisms in a logical order, support claims with the supplied evidence, label diagrams precisely, and distinguish a description of the data from an explanation of why the pattern occurs.

Frequently asked questions

What does IB Biology SL cover?

IB Biology SL studies life through four themes: unity and diversity, form and function, interaction and interdependence, and continuity and change. Topics are connected across molecules, cells, organisms, and ecosystems.

Which syllabus applies to the current IB Biology course?

The current Biology course began teaching in August or September 2023 and was first assessed in 2025. Students should confirm their examination session and any guide updates with their school.

How is IB Biology SL assessed?

External assessment is worth 80%: Paper 1 lasts one hour and 30 minutes and contributes 36%, while Paper 2 lasts one hour and 30 minutes and contributes 44%. The scientific investigation internal assessment contributes 20%.

What is in IB Biology SL Paper 1?

Paper 1 combines Paper 1A multiple-choice questions with Paper 1B data-based questions. Paper 1B uses syllabus-related data across the course themes, so students need both biological understanding and careful evidence interpretation.

What is the current IB Biology scientific investigation?

The scientific investigation is an open-ended individual task in which a student gathers and analyses data to answer a self-formulated research question. The written report has a maximum overall word count of 3,000 words and contributes 20% at both SL and HL.
